Concrete Foreman

We are looking for a highly skilled and experienced Concrete Foreman to oversee and manage concrete construction projects from start to finish.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in concrete work, excellent leadership abilities, and a commitment to safety and quality. As a Concrete Foreman, you will be responsible for supervising a team of concrete workers, coordinating with project managers and subcontractors, and ensuring that all work is completed on time, within budget, and to the highest standards. The Concrete Foreman will be expected to read and interpret blueprints and technical drawings, plan daily work activities, and ensure that all materials and equipment are available and used efficiently. You will also be responsible for enforcing safety regulations, conducting site inspections, and maintaining accurate records of work progress and labor hours.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are essential, as you will be the primary point of contact between the field crew and project leadership. This role requires a deep understanding of concrete forming, pouring, finishing, and curing techniques. You should be able to identify and resolve issues quickly, adapt to changing project requirements, and motivate your team to perform at their best. The ability to operate heavy equipment and tools related to concrete work is a plus. Responsibilities

  • Supervise and coordinate concrete construction crews
  • Interpret blueprints and project specifications
  • Plan and schedule daily work activities
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and procedures
  • Monitor quality of work and adherence to project timelines
  • Communicate with project managers and subcontractors
  • Maintain accurate records of labor, materials, and progress
  • Train and mentor crew members
  • Inspect work areas and equipment for safety and functionality
  • Resolve on-site issues and conflicts efficiently

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in concrete construction
  • Proven leadership and supervisory experience
  • Strong knowledge of concrete techniques and materials
  • Ability to read and interpret construction drawings
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ills
  • Familiarity with safety regulations and procedures
  • Physical stamina and ability to work in various weather conditions
  • Valid driver's license
  • Ability to operate concrete-related tools and equipment
